Former Moroka Swallows striker Daniel Gozar, who hails from Ghana, has resolved his contractual issue with the Soweto club. Gozar was part of Swallows from 2020 to 2023 and was loaned to Black Leopards during the 2021/22 season. After leaving the Dobsonville-based club, he had a remaining contract and took the matter to FIFA through legal channels.

FIFA ruled in his favor, and it has been confirmed that the club has begun paying the owed amount to Gozar. This resolution indicates that Gozar will receive the money owed to him, bringing finality to the matter.
